About me and my passion for cars
My passion for cars (GM for the most part) started when i was about 19. I had just gotten my first car that i purchased from a local car dealer and i was rather excited about it. It wasnt much, a 95 base model Chevy Lumina with a 3100 V6, but it was mine. I wanted to do what i could to it.
After a couple years, and learning about a certain model Lumina (LTZ w/ Buick 3.8 n/a), i set out for one of those. I found one and traded my base model up for the LTZ. I had it for nearly four years, one of the best cars i ever had! Then while taking classes in college to work on cars, i bought my first Quad4 powered car. A 1988 Olds Cutlass Calais. It had a blown headgasket, so i fixed it for the school (it was donated to the school), then bought it from them for $100. Drove it for about a year till i found my new love, sitting at a junkyard here in town, just begging to be bought and fixed.
My GTZ was in sad shape the day i saw her waiting for someone to buy her. Im good friends with the guy that owns the lot, so he made me a hell of a deal. $500 and it was mine, she was still drivable. So i went to the bank, got a $500 loan, and drove her home the next day. Thats been about 4 years now, and she still lives. After an extensive motor build, a tranny overhaul, and a lot of work, i still have her.
Because of my GTZ and how much i love it, i fell in love with the Beretta line of GM cars. Since last year, i have sold my LTZ and replaced it with a 94 base Beretta with a 3100 auto (so my wife can drive it). The base has the same motor my first Lumina had and i love it!
Now, i'm more into the RWD muscle cars. Thinking that owning a rwd car was dumb for the longest time, when i bought my GTO i asked myself why i didnt buy one sooner? The power and the feel of driving a muscle car is just incredible! I think from now on, if i decide to buy another car, if its not rwd, i dont want it! lol
